France’s President Emmanuel Macron staged an impressive return to the world stage using the reopening of Notre Dame Cathedral as an opportunity to broker talks between Ukraine’s Volodymyr Zelenskyy and US President-elect Donald Trump against a backdrop that eclipsed other European leaders.

The ceremony came at the end of a challenging week for the French president, after the collapse of the government, which left the country rudderless.

Two days before the ceremony Macron was vowing to see out his remaining 30-month term as president despite calls for his resignation.
